Only 8 percent of religiously unaffiliated Americans — including 8 percent of atheists — say that having a different view about God would make it impossible to date someone. About one in four Americans say it would be impossible to date someone who did not share their views on the existence of God. Thirty-eight percent of the public say this would make things difficult, but not impossible. Twenty percent of the public say it would not be possible to date someone who did not have the same view on this issue as they did.

Although politics is a regular conversation topic among most couples, few report that it is a major source of contention in their relationship. When Americans are asked which topic they are most likely to argue with their spouse or significant other about, money and household chores are cited more frequently than other issues. Thirteen percent say they most often argue about in-laws and other extended family members, while an identical number say how they spend time together is the most important source of contention. Eight percent say they are most likely to argue about children.

Only 20 percent of Americans who have ever used an online dating website or app say they shared their political views in their profile. About one-third included information about their religious beliefs on their profile page. In contrast, roughly three-quarters report including hobbies and interests in their online profile.
